Dramatically Improve Existing 5 µm and 3 µm Fully Porous HPLC Methods (TN-1132)
With virtually no development effort or investment required, chromatographers running traditional HPLC methods can instantly improve resolution, sensitivity, and productivity by simply replacing 5 µm and 3 µm fully porous columns with a Kinetex 5 µm core-shell column.
